Derby Road station offers a modest array of facilities to assist your journey. While you won't find a ticket office here, fear not — several modern ticket machines stand ready for you to purchase or collect your tickets effortlessly. These machines are fully accessible, ensuring every traveler can use them without hassle. Keeping customer service in mind, there are information points and help points throughout the station, making it straightforward to access any help you might need. However, you'll find the station devoid of refreshment facilities, shops, or cash machines, so consider grabbing a coffee or withdrawing cash beforehand.
Travelers can rest easy knowing that Derby Road is fairly accommodating for those with mobility needs. The station provides step-free access to its platforms, allowing for an easy transition from the roadside to the waiting areas. However, be prepared for a short stroll if you need to transfer between platforms. While accessible ticket machines and an induction loop make purchasing a breeze, note that the station lacks ramps for train access, accessible toilets, and waiting rooms.

When you arrive at Filton Abbey Wood, you'll find the facilities modest but convenient.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 16:15 to 19:15. You'll also find ticket machines, enabling you to collect tickets purchased online. The station features an induction loop for those who are hearing impaired.
Filton Abbey Wood provides step-free platform access through a ramp bridge. However, the gradient might be steeper than current guidelines suggest. Although there are no waiting rooms or separate lounges, there is a seating area available. Make note: there aren't any toilets or baby-changing facilities present.
Parking is a breeze with available spaces that are open 24/7, and it's free. Unfortunately, if you've got a craving or need cash, you might need to wait until you reach your destination as there are no refreshment facilities or ATMs available on-site.
